titleOfInvention Automatic poison dispenser for rodent destructive animals and poison preparation for use therewith
abstract The automatic poison dispenser consists of a tubular element (5) intended for being mounted vertically at a wall (2), a pole or the like and containing stacked solid poison rods (13). At the lower part of the tubular element there are means (8) allowing an end portion (13') of the lowest poison rod (13) to be exposed for destructive animals at a certain distance from a floor (3). Screening means (9) prevent dogs, cats, etc. from getting access to the exposed end portion (13') of the poison rod. A poison preparation in the form of solid rods (13) contain poison but for an upper end portion (13"). To advantage the rods contain a mixture of poisoned so-called dry bait (typically about 2/3) and a stabilizing material or holder, preferably paraffin (typically about 1/3).
